5th Grade State Floats

Written by Frankie, 5th grade student
Recently, fifth grade students presented state float projects. It was a fun and creative process to learn more about the 50 states that comprise our great nation. We each chose a state to research and, over the course of three weeks, gathered important facts about our state and created a small float to reveal our findings about our chosen state.  We each gave a presentation to our class about our float. We improved in our public speaking skills and even had the opportunity to receive feedback from our friends. Now the floats are on display in the hall just outside the spiral staircase on the third floor, waiting for you to see them!
